Three of the Democrats running for U.S. Senate were in Newark on Thursday for a forum to answer voters’ questions. The city’s mayor – Cory Booker – wasn’t.
Instead, Booker, now the front-runner in that Senate primary race, spent the evening in Jersey City at a $1,000-per-person fundraiser featuring Oprah Winfrey. “VIP” tickets, which included a photo with the mayor, cost $2,600 – the maximum campaign donation allowed under state law.
Donors could also meet the actor Denzel Washington, who was believed to be in attendance.
The fundraiser was expected to bring in about $250,000, according to Jersey City Mayor Steve Fulop.
At the same time as the fundraiser, the three other Democrats running in the Aug. 13 primary were in a community center about seven blocks from Newark’s City Hall. Faded and peeling murals looked down on the candidates: Monmouth County Rep. Frank Pallone, Assembly Speaker Sheila Oliver and Mercer County Rep. Rush Holt.
